somehow age can be one cause of having secondary infertility. maybe you are in your late 30s-40s and with this the chance to conceive will slow down. |
||
|
||
|
you're right. cleoffel, consider your age. you should also take note that you may have already a damaged fallopian tube. this occurs when you get a couple of complications during your first pregnancy or by the time of the delivery. |
||
|
||
|
it may cause pelvic infection too which lead to blockage of the fallopian tubes and that it reduce the chance of the egg to be fertilized. |
||
|
||
|
if you have been gaining weight since your first pregnancy, this one's a tough reason why you are having hard time with the 2nd one. the weight is significant in conceiving. this will interfer your ovulation and will cause imbalances of your hormones. |
||
|
||
|
chances are, you need to go on diet. a research even shows that even if you had a little lost of weight this can improve the chance of conceiving. |
||
|
||
|
in some cases, the problem is not with you. maybe, just maybe your partner is having trouble with his sperm count. |
||
|
||
|
yes men can be a victim of infertility too. they will get low sperm count especially when they had chronic illnesses like high blood pressure or diabetes. |
